酷代码 AI
菜单

输入: 一个整数n,表示巨龙会在喷火次数是n的倍数时哑火。 输出: 一个整数,表示超硬盾承受的总热量第一次超过15的时候,当时的总热量。

以下是使用 Python 实现该功能的代码: ```python # 获取输入的整数 n n = int(input()) # 初始化总热量和喷火次数 total_heat = 0 fire_count = 0 # 模拟巨龙喷火过程 while total_heat <= 15: fire_count += 1 # 判断巨龙是否哑火 if fire_count % n != 0: # 巨龙喷火,热量加1 total_heat += 1 # 输出超硬盾承受的总热量第一次超过15的时候的总热量 print(total_heat) ``` 代码解释: 1. 获取输入:使用 `input()` 函数获取用户输入的整数 `n`,并使用 `int()` 函数将其转换为整数类型。 2. 初始化变量:初始化总热量 `total_heat` 为 0,喷火次数 `fire_count` 为 0。 3. 模拟巨龙喷火过程:使用 `while` 循环模拟巨龙喷火,直到总热量超过 15 为止。在每次循环中,喷火次数加 1,并判断当前喷火次数是否是 `n` 的倍数。如果不是,则巨龙喷火,总热量加 1。 4. 输出结果:当总热量超过 15 时,循环结束,输出当前的总热量。 [2026-01-23 20:37:46 | AI问答 | 304点数解答]

服务商
相关提问
发财导航,免费问AI
实用工具查看更多